All about undefined

Interested in learning more?

  • 8022 0981683

    526 15 53655 2124360637

    See more
  • 0833181 51398 1468942

    91223 8060342572 2126 09086244

    See more
  • 481 936535685

    95406397505 04 36309448 037

    See more